About This Item

Gifford Golf Club, 2008. 1st Edition . Hardcover. Fine/Fine. Hardback. A fine copy in a fine dustwrapper. This is copy no.222 but the limitation is not given. Pp.[vi].92. Numerous illustrations with some in colour. End-papers showing layout of the course. The history of an East Lothian golf club.

About Blacket Books

Blacket Books is the business name of Liz and Ian Laing, who have been selling second-hand and antiquarian books since 1985. We are general booksellers but with some emphasis on Scottish, military and childrens books, and modern first editions. We are members of the Provincial Booksellers Fairs Association (PBFA) and sell at book fairs throughout Scotland and the north of England. Our aim is to offer for sale worthwhile, collectable books at reasonable prices.
